Solve.The monthly payment p on a mortgage varies directly with the amount borrowed b. Suppose that you decide to borrow $120,000 using a 30-year mortgage. You are told that your monthly payment is $662.41. Write a linear function that relates the monthly payment p to the amount borrowed b for a mortgage with the same terms.
A. p(b) = 119,337.59b
B. p(b) = 0.0060219b
C. p(b) = 181.16b
D. p(b) = 0.0055201b
Answer: D
